HB1533

AN ACT to amend Tennessee Code Annotated, Title 57 and Title 67, relative to alcoholic beverages.

Failed·3/3/26

Extends the time limit for submitting objections to alcoholic beverage permits from five to ten days.

This bill amends Tennessee law to change the time limit for submitting objections to alcoholic beverage permits. It extends the period from five to ten days, giving more time for public input on permit applications. This act takes effect immediately upon becoming law.
